XAI EXTENDS GROK IMAGINE VIDEO GENERATION TO 10 SECONDS WITH QUALITY ENHANCEMENTS xAI has updated its Grok Imagine tool to produce videos lasting 10 seconds, doubling the prior limit. This change, along with refinements in visual and audio elements, expands the tool's utility for short-form content creation. xAI released the upgrade to Grok Imagine in early 2026. The company, founded by Elon Musk, announced the feature through posts on the X platform. This follows previous iterations where videos were capped at shorter durations, typically 5 seconds. Grok Imagine allows users to generate videos from text prompts, building on its image creation capabilities. The update addresses constraints in video length that limited expressive potential. Users can now input descriptions to create clips, such as animations or scenes, without needing initial images. This positions the tool within the broader landscape of AI-driven multimodal generation, where text-to-video systems are increasingly common. The core adjustment doubles the maximum video duration from 5 seconds to 10 seconds. Accompanying this are upgrades to video quality, including more stable visuals, richer details, and improved clarity. Audio has also been enhanced for better output, making the generated content more immersive. These changes were described as "big improvements across the board" in the announcement. No specific benchmarks or quantitative metrics for the quality improvements were detailed in the release statements. The feature rollout appears gradual, with some users accessing it via the Grok app or web interface. xAI has not introduced user controls for exact timing, though such options are mentioned as future possibilities.
